The 0.3 updates to
wasi:httpin wasi-http/#143 helped highlight the fact that the reasoning for why we want to be able to pass anerror-contextintostream.close-readableand get anerror-contextout ofstream.readapplies just as well in the opposite direction (tostream.close-writableandstream.write, resp.). This PR basically just removes one of the few asymmetries from the otherwise-quite-symmetric read/write code.
